Solution for 7x-2x+6=21 equation:


Simplifying
7x + -2x + 6 = 21

Reorder the terms:
6 + 7x + -2x = 21

Combine like terms: 7x + -2x = 5x
6 + 5x = 21

Solving
6 + 5x = 21

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-6' to each side of the equation.
6 + -6 + 5x = 21 + -6

Combine like terms: 6 + -6 = 0
0 + 5x = 21 + -6
5x = 21 + -6

Combine like terms: 21 + -6 = 15
5x = 15

Divide each side by '5'.
x = 3

Simplifying
x = 3
